Rock Hill is a locality in York County, South Carolina, United States. With a population of 240,159, Rock Hill is a major urban centre in South Carolina. The population density is 648.9 people per km². Rock Hill is located at 34.9249°N, 81.0251°W. It observes the Eastern Time (America/New_York) timezone. ZIP code: 29732.
Rock Hill sits upon the Piedmont plateau, a landscape gently rolling and fertile, once carpeted with forests and now crisscrossed by the meandering Catawba River, a vital artery for the region's historical development. It lies 7.3 miles south-west of Fort Mill, SC (from Fort Mill, SC: bearing 218°T), and is situated 6.9 miles south of Tega Cay. Its early growth was profoundly shaped by agriculture, particularly cotton, a legacy that eventually gave way to industrialization, transforming the agrarian quietude into a hub of manufacturing and commerce. This economic metamorphosis, fueled by an industrious spirit, has provided a steady foundation for Rock Hill, allowing it to evolve into a vibrant center for trade and innovation. The cultural character of Rock Hill reflects a blend of Southern tradition and forward-looking dynamism, a spirit evident in its welcoming atmosphere and commitment to progress. Visitors can find solace and inspiration at the historic Old Stone Church, a silent witness to generations of life and change, or wander through the verdant grounds of Glencairn Garden, where the light filters softly through the trees. Winthrop University, a beacon of higher learning, contributes significantly to the intellectual and artistic life of Rock Hill, drawing bright minds and fostering a culture of inquiry.
